  text: A picosecond acoustic pulse can be used to control the lasing emission from
    semiconductor nanostructures by shifting their electronic transitions. When the
    active medium, here an ensemble of (In,Ga)As quantum dots, is shifted into or
    out of resonance with the cavity mode, a large enhancement or suppression of the
    lasing emission can dynamically be achieved. Most interesting, even in the case
    when gain medium and cavity mode are in resonance, we observe an enhancement of
    the lasing due to shaking by coherent phonons. In order to understand the interactions
    of the nonlinearly coupled photon-exciton-phonon subsystems, we develop a semiclassical
    model and find an excellent agreement between theory and experiment.

  text: 'We develop a nanoscopy method with in-depth resolution for layered photonic
    devices. Photonics often requires tailored light field distributions for the optical
    modes used, and an exact knowledge of the geometry of a device is crucial to assess
    its performance. The presented acousto-optical nanoscopy method is based on the
    uniqueness of the light field distributions in photonic devices: for a given wavelength,
    we record the reflectivity modulation during the transit of a picosecond acoustic
    pulse. The temporal profile obtained can be linked to the internal light field
    distribution. From this information, a reverse-engineering procedure allows us
    to reconstruct the light field and the underlying photonic structure very precisely.
    We apply this method to the slow light mode of an AlAs/GaAs micropillar resonator
    and show its validity for the tailored experimental conditions.'

  text: In budget games, players compete over resources with finite budgets. For every
    resource, a player has a specific demand and as a strategy, he chooses a subset
    of resources. If the total demand on a resource does not exceed its budget, the
    utility of each player who chose that resource equals his demand. Otherwise, the
    budget is shared proportionally. In the general case, pure Nash equilibria (NE)
    do not exist for such games. In this paper, we consider the natural classes of
    singleton and matroid budget games with additional constraints and show that for
    each, pure NE can be guaranteed. In addition, we introduce a lexicographical potential
    function to prove that every matroid budget game has an approximate pure NE which
    depends on the largest ratio between the different demands of each individual
    player.

  text: 'Many processes in industrial and domestic applications require heating or
    cooling at certain steps of a process. Even if the process itself cannot be shifted
    towards periods of high PV output (which would be favorable), the heating and
    cooling necessities can be carried out via an inexpensive thermal storage instead
    of a costly electrical storage. Examples are: distillation units, washing machines,
    dishwashers, coolers, freezers. The resulting “shiftability” of power consumption
    can be a business model by offering that availability of load dispatching on the
    balancing power market. An example using PCM as cooling storage for refrigerators
    that has been investigated: A focus of this paper is the use of that load shifting
    ability to provide balancing power. Another emphasis is on the protection of individual
    consumer data: To keep the state of use of each individual consumer (actually:
    interactive consumer or “prosumer”) anonymous, but still performing the sales
    of balancing power, the orders for load-dispatching can be transmitted via transmitted
    via a regional, non-individual broadcasting message within the GSM network. Demonstrating
    DSMs capacities, abilities and limits concerning domestic applications is an important
    task to prepare large-scale implementation and to convince stakeholders. To reaching
    that goal, several realistic DSM scenarios for cooling applications and freezers
    have been developed with the prerequisite that DSM activities are supposed to
    be without comfort losses and without restrictions for consumers while the limits
    for lower and upper temperature for food are maintained.'
